It was a frustrating watch. Reminiscent of our performances last season albeit not quite as bad. No criticism can really come the way of Leuluai, Cust or Field, as you literally cannot create anything as a playmaker in that situation where the opposition are so dominant.

We were our own worst enemy at times in terms of poor defensive reads, poor discipline and some really basic errors. The pack is a bit of a worry. The starting middles of Singleton, Ellis and Isa have looked ineffective in a few games already this year. When we played Leeds it was most apparent but they were so woeful they couldn't take advantage but there was always a worry that a better team would do. Catalans did. Byrne was okay coming off the bench but couldn't do much by himself.

Farrell and Bateman were very disappointing. I thought we missed a trick by keeping Pearce-Paul at centre throughout the game. He was making some strong carries and he's our best offloader and as the game went on we were desperate for anything that could spark a break. Having him isolated out wide was a waste, as was keeping Shorrocks on the bench and then using him at hooker. What we had been doing wasn't working but there was absolutely no willingness to try and do anything different - despite showing in the first few games that we can be unpredictable and versatile.

No need to panic, but a definite wake up call.
